Class BaselineModuleJvmArgs.ModuleJvmArgsArgumentProvider
java.lang.Object
com.palantir.baseline.plugins.BaselineModuleJvmArgs.ModuleJvmArgsArgumentProvider
- All Implemented Interfaces:
org.gradle.process.CommandLineArgumentProvider
- Enclosing class:
BaselineModuleJvmArgs
public abstract static class BaselineModuleJvmArgs.ModuleJvmArgsArgumentProvider
extends Object
implements org.gradle.process.CommandLineArgumentProvider
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ionfromClasspathAndExtension(org.gradle.api.Task task, Callable<org.gradle.api.file.FileCollection> classpathCallable) fromJustClasspath(org.gradle.api.Task task, Callable<org.gradle.api.file.FileCollection> classpathCallable) fromJustExtensionForCompilation(org.gradle.api.Task task) abstract org.gradle.api.provider.Property<String> abstract org.gradle.api.provider.SetProperty<String> abstract org.gradle.api.provider.SetProperty<String> getOpens()protected abstract org.gradle.api.provider.ProviderFactorywithExtraDescription(String description)
-
Constructor Details
-
ModuleJvmArgsArgumentProvider
public ModuleJvmArgsArgumentProvider()
-
-
Method Details
-
getExports
-
getOpens
-
getDescription
-
getProviderFactory
@Inject protected abstract org.gradle.api.provider.ProviderFactory getProviderFactory() -
asArguments
-
allModulesPackagePairUnnamed
-
fromJustClasspath
public static BaselineModuleJvmArgs.ModuleJvmArgsArgumentProvider fromJustClasspath(org.gradle.api.Task task, Callable<org.gradle.api.file.FileCollection> classpathCallable) -
fromJustExtensionForCompilation
public static BaselineModuleJvmArgs.ModuleJvmArgsArgumentProvider fromJustExtensionForCompilation(org.gradle.api.Task task) -
fromClasspathAndExtension
public static BaselineModuleJvmArgs.ModuleJvmArgsArgumentProvider fromClasspathAndExtension(org.gradle.api.Task task, Callable<org.gradle.api.file.FileCollection> classpathCallable) -
withExtraDescription
public final BaselineModuleJvmArgs.ModuleJvmArgsArgumentProvider withExtraDescription(String description)
-